stand: More sensible defaults when ConOut is missing
When ConOut is missing, we used to default to serial. Except we did it in the worst way possible by just setting the howto bits and not updating the console setting, which lead to weird behavior where we'd get some things on the video port, others on serial. Instead, set console to "efi,comconsole" for this case. Also set RB_MULTIPLE always (so we get dual consoles from the kernel) and or in RB_SERIAL when we can't find GOPs that suggest the precense of a video console. This will put output in the most places and have a sensible default for 'primary' console. Sponsored by: Netflix Reviewed by: emaste, manu Differential Revision: https://reviews.freebsd.org/D36299
